Good Turning Chisels. These chisels are used to shape, carve, and cut wood on a lathe to create a variety of objects such as bowls, vases, and furniture legs. As an alternative, you can purchase carbide tipped wood turning chisels, where the tips can be easily rotated or replaced. Thus, getting the perfect carbide. They could be perfect for some hand carving or sculpting work as long as you keep away from trying to hammer them. They are not used with a hammer on. Most traditionalists recommend buying conventional turning chisels and a sharpener, but maintaining sharp tools will take a lot of time. The best carbide woodturning chisels allow you to focus on the craft rather than its sharpening. The chisels are made up of three parts, the handle, the shank, and the blade. Chisels for woodturning lathes have unique designs for gouging, parting, and other cuts. Wood turning chisels are essential tools for woodturners who create beautiful, functional objects from raw wood.
